The documentary-style camerawork made audiences feel like they were getting an exclusive, behind-the-scenes look at their idols.

The sequence featuring the song "Can't Buy Me Love"—where the band runs, leaps, and plays in an open field—is widely cited by media historians as the birth of the modern music video. When MTV launched nearly two decades later, its founders explicitly credited A Hard Day's Night as a primary inspiration.
